Abstract
In this study, 3-alkyl(aryl)-4-amino-4,5-dihydro-1H-1,2,4-triazol-5-ones 2 have been reacted with 3-(4-methoxybenzenesulfonyloxy)-4-methoxybenzaldehyde 1 to afford the corresponding nine new 3-alkyl(aryl)-4-[ 3-(4methoxybenzenesulfonyloxy)-4-methoxybenzylideneamino]-4,5-dihydro-1H-1,2,4-triazol-5-ones 3. The structures of nine new compounds have been characterized by IR, H-1 and C-13 NMR spectral data. The synthesized compounds have been analyzed for their in vitro antioxidant and antimicrobial activities. Furthermore, the half-neutralization potential values and the corresponding pK(a) values were determined for all the newly synthesized compounds.
